Sold a BIN item this morning but the buyer wanted to cancel luckily before I went off to post it.


Went through the eBay process of buyer "wanted to cancel" etc but on checking PayPal they have refunded buyer his payment less 41p fee reversal. Is this right?


Also, in "my eBay" the said item is cancelled and everything seems OK but on the left of page it is still showing as £8.99 in red waiting for payment. Is this normal?
